I am an Australian Fantasy Author, publishing independently under the pen name Ella Stradling. Ella Stradling is a pseudonym derived from two sources: Ella is my real middle name, given by my father in honour of his favourite singer, Ella Fitzgerald; Stradling comes from a legend about a girl who was the last of her line who married into the family.
I grew up on the Central Coast of New South Wales, Australia and finished high school in 1988. I graduated from University as Bachelor of Arts with Honours in 1994. I worked for over ten years as graphic designer, editor and proof reader in the pre-press department of a small offset and digital printing house.
My first novel, a fantasy titled "Revealing Rexa" and its sequel, "Awakening Sand", are both available on kindle and in paperback. A manuscript comprising these first two novels was a semi-finalist in the 2011 Amazon Breakthrough Novel Award, placing in the top 1% of the competition.
